MARCANE’S NEW SINGLE “DESPITE THE SHARPEST KNIVES” REFUSES TO FIT IN A BOX
Marcane recently dropped “Despite the Sharpest Knives," a dynamic metal single that takes genre-bending soundscapes and amplifies them with lyrics about the complexity of humanity. The whiplash you get when listening to the track is intense, from the trap-like beats that appear at the beginning of the song to the powerful guitar breakdown throughout. It is hard to pinpoint just one umbrella that it fits into, as the song directs you around into multiple different sonic avenues.
No matter where you scrub in the song, there’s going to be a different vibe at each place that you land on.
Similar to the likes of Bring Me The Horizon, Marcane pairs experimental sounds with a more traditional metal aura. The slower parts are reminiscent of Deftones, capturing that same dark and intense energy that the band is known for. Some of that Bad Omens influence peaks its head out, with breathy vocals and a melody that guides you along like a storybook. If I were to compare Marcane with a more rap-based artist, Ghostemane would be my pick.
The lyricism expressed in this song is phenomenal, especially when conveyed by such a haunting voice. Vocal effects used towards the end give the song a whole new level, with an echoing, videogame-like effect that really adds to its charm.
Overall, “Despite the Sharpest Knives” is an avant-garde metalcore song that showcases Marcane’s diverse skill set in crafting epic pieces. Stay on the lookout for his EP, which is anticipated to be released later this year.
